Straight answers.
The instrument is one evidence source inside a decision we help you run: we define what AI-ready means for your organisation, measure it, and land the results where decisions happen. They sell the test; we run the decision.
Three dimensions on everyone (AI literacy and skills, behavioral adoption, calibrated trust) at three depths by role: use AI, work with AI, build with AI. Real scenarios and knowledge items, scored consistently against an expert key.
You can inflate a self-rating, not a demonstrated score. Skills are measured on what people show, scored the same way every time, and the gap between claimed and demonstrated is itself a signal.
Connectors get built against real engagements: say Workday in the scoping conversation and it’s part of the plan. Results land where you work; nothing new to adopt.
